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"WinAPI";
Текущий архив: 2005.07.25;
Скачать: [xml.tar.bz2];

Вниз

Копирование файлов   Найти похожие ветки 

 
lucifer ©   (2005-05-31 17:01) [0]

Я знаю, что это довольно наболевшая тема форумов, но всё же!
Есть диск в дисководе. Надо скопировать все файлы (ну хотя бы на примере одного) в какой-то каталог. Важно то, чтобы копирование проходило чем быстрей - тем лучше. И чтобы не было видно процесса копирования на экране монитора!
Заранее благодарен!


 
Anatoly Podgoretsky ©   (2005-05-31 17:05) [1]

ShFileOperation


 
Digitman ©   (2005-05-31 17:09) [2]


> знаю, что это довольно наболевшая тема форумов


с чего ты взял ?)
как раз ты чуть ли не первый)..


> Есть диск в дисководе


уже хорошо.
лажно хоть не плюшка с маком)


> Надо скопировать все файлы (ну хотя бы на примере одного)
> в какой-то каталог


вполне приличное желание.
возражений вроде бы нет)


> Важно то, чтобы копирование проходило чем быстрей - тем
> лучше


многое от тебя, программиста, зависит.


> чтобы не было видно процесса копирования на экране монитора


так не показывай ! ... и видно не будет) ... сомневаешься ? приводи факты ..


 
lucifer ©   (2005-05-31 17:15) [3]

Не ну если серьёзно. Еслить путь к файлу (допустим: d:\filename.exe), есть путь к каталогу, в который надо этот файл скопировать (к примеру: С:\ТЕМР).
Как скопировать, чтобы пользователь ничего не увидел на экране монитора. А что касаеться быстроты, то есть много (по-моему) алгоритмов для копирования, так что посоветуете??


 
alpet ©   (2005-05-31 17:17) [4]

CopyFile - очень быстрая функция насколько я знаю, что мешает ее пользовать ?


 
Игорь Шевченко ©   (2005-05-31 17:18) [5]

lucifer ©   (31.05.05 17:15) [3]

Пользователь увидит обращение к дисководу и будет очень удивлен.


 
Digitman ©   (2005-05-31 17:18) [6]


> Как скопировать, чтобы пользователь ничего не увидел на
> экране монитора


АП [1] тебе не указ ?)


> что касаеться быстроты, то есть много (по-моему) алгоритмов
> для копирования, так что посоветуете


любой, имеющий минимум вызовов оболочки

например, использующий напрямую DeviceIOControl() ..



Страницы: 1 вся ветка

Форум: "WinAPI";
Текущий архив: 2005.07.25;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.45 MB
Время: 0.01 c
4-1117348054
NikNet
2005-05-29 10:27
2005.07.25
Как целую DWORD значение разделить на BYTE


1-1120929749
tazik
2005-07-09 21:22
2005.07.25
частичное оформление в Вин ХП


1-1120663517
Vasya.ru
2005-07-06 19:25
2005.07.25
Вопрос мой закрыли, ответа не получил


14-1120138292
Narik
2005-06-30 17:31
2005.07.25
Интернет браузер


4-1117241679
gdaujk
2005-05-28 04:54
2005.07.25
Дочерние контролы дочерних контролов :-)





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ский